3 AXES LINEAR DRIVE FIBRE LASER MACHINE FULLY FEATURED, HIGHLY EFFICIENT HIGH SPEED, HIGH ACCURACY, ENERGY SAVING The FLC-3015AJ combines 2 important characteristics for modern laser cutting. All 3 axes are linear driven and the laser source is Amada’s latest in-house developed fibre technology. The combination of these elements and Amada’s proven automation options provide you with a new solution for your manufacturing requirements.

HIGH QUALITY PROCESSING OF HIGHLY REFLECTIVE MATERIALS PROCESS RANGE EXPANSION Wavelength and absorption by metals Fibre laser Aluminium Steel High abso rptio n The fibre laser has a shorter wavelength and is 3 to 4 times more easily absorbed than traditional CO2 lasers. This enables high-quality processing of highly-reflective, difficult to process materials such as aluminium, brass, copper and titanium. FUNCTIONS AND OPTIONAL EQUIPMENT Monitoring eyes Optical fiber Scattered radiation Lens Process Monitoring System Factors that may cause processing defects, such as through piercing, gouging and plasma, are constantly monitored. The process monitoring function ensures continuous and stable processing. Before piercing medium thickness sheets, oil is sprayed on the material to prevent spatter build-up, improve processing quality and achieve stable processing. Cutting Lenses ‘One Touch’ Lens and Nozzle Exchange The OVS IV system measures the pitch of two reference holes and automatically compensates for any origin deviation when transferring a sheet of parts from the punch machine. The pitch and circularity of the cut holes are also measured. When the measured values fall outside the specified limits, an alarm is activated.
